php

PHP get_defined_vars 모든 변수 출력

duraboys 2014. 7. 24. 18:19

디버깅할때 유용합니다만 노출되면 ㄷㄷㄷㄷㄷ;


이 함수는 환경 변수, 서버 변수, 사용자가 정의한 변수등에 모든 변수의 목록을 가진 다차원 배열입니다.


  $arr = get_defined_vars();

      //print_r(array_keys(get_defined_vars()));  

    foreach ( $arr as $vName => $value )

    {

        echo $vName." : ".$value."<br>";

    }

exit();


보안 처리 하실려면 PHP.INI 에 disable_functions = get_defined_vars